Kayleigh Rae (born 11 August 1992), better known as Kay Lee Ray, is a Scottish professional wrestler. She is currently signed to WWE, where she performs on the NXT brand under the ring name Alba Fyre and is one-half of the current NXT Women's Tag Team Champions with Isla Dawn in their first reign. Rae began her wrestling career in 2009 and competed on the European independent circuit. She joined Insane Championship Wrestling in 2011, and while there, became a three-time ICW Women's Champion.
